Dear Parents and Guardians,

Playing in a youth orchestra may be helpful for some students to help them develop coordination, and balance. Being in an orchestra also often helps a student develop social and team-playing skills. Here are the web-sites of some local orchestras. There is no one 'best orchestra'. Please discuss with Denise which orchestra may be appropriate to meet your child's needs.
